Transaction 276ed100fcf59ecd52059c58dca94951112668eabc7ecee3af5a786350011816
1 Input
1 Output
-
276ed100fcf59ecd52059c58dca94951112668eabc7ecee3af5a786350011816:0
- value
- 3478772
- script pubkey
- OP_0 OP_PUSHBYTES_20 bbfddd0bd8372958ef3d8b78770144bc6e0420fa
- address
- bc1qh07a6z7cxu543mea3du8wq2yh3hqgg86j6nwj3